Type
ORACLE
Validation date
2024-07-01 12:19: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01626,
    "usd": 0.01748
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00012A2D72C9D0AB2A499EFD2AA767E9596A1D7F9B443B0A8C5F1EE768D0A83ECDA6

Previous signature

E18DE9308F9441F1FDE1BA7A41E3F99EEBF0AD3082423C1F4BCEFD74199B1BD70DF165ED42689C6A2952DD86EA78001AA07F8D09D6090A3DD68D6D34E6833303

Origin signature

3046022100824AA44CD8F91F282EA8548C84DCCB95460BDAD4CE766AFA2C5611BBA11FBA05022100CE0BE779CF35F192FAB4F9F865D15968D5F8C584DEE77DC1639CDE6E529B452C

Proof of work

0101045C26E67A34DA3A7512FAAD9E7DAFCEF231F20CD9E3138B2D278C1813C82D093B20D589C24BFAF36848E50CCC9F9B750F6C02AB3C4E7C9B16D3BC9D99AAB609BB

Proof of integrity

0075A3DD24325FF5C4A5335D83BD800E0BBF061472A93DB1313A8F3D03A6DF5B86

Coordinator signature

F5A3F5B38EE97600E52C1AF163EE617FD0816BDB913009B06F6CAA727052D94B108B9FA6F2D9702CDF6211E6749AFE901914E028B3F66EA867FDF71DA667EE04

Validator #1 public key

00019BD68EFC0CBF59391FDF1745E04FCDCBB379C6FB428B9A8B4ACF0D71FC82BD68

Validator #1 signature

3D397C8C1F5C06273C7F0FE9DBF21D8610AB68BE23F77FA7A5430D7A435D7E0C62F00B796C8099B79B9ACD785F3DB3B4B71253CAB6E3B39A4435EDE132EBD506

Validator #2 public key

000109D2AF3B2BD8197A9343B9059782ACB6480F847B538F2CC8328E7D257E2DB785

Validator #2 signature

A31EAD761055D2E72FE876AE3489CA42FB9847366CBF2F0C1536A589AEE99E2281EAFFBDCA2A82290FCF3B40FD65F4F8E7AF1B78FF2277FA211C74718B1FB50F